Re: Problem installing Mavic freehub body [skid777]
Is it doing this with the cassette installed, or with it off? Because there is a spacer needed behind the cassette if you use a campy 11 speed freehub on an older mavic wheel. If you don't use the spacer, the inboard side of the largest cog can rub on the hub shell.

As well, just in case, here's the excerpt from the manual. I know you said you put the washer in and tried another, but that symptom is exactly what happens without the washer.
